Lu et al., Mol Cell 2007
:
XIAP induces
NF-kappaB activation via the BIR1/TAB1 interaction and BIR1 dimerization ... In addition to caspase inhibition,
X-linked inhibitor of apoptosis (XIAP)
induces NF-kappaB and MAP kinase activation during TGF-b and BMP receptor signaling and upon overexpression ... Structure based mutagenesis and knockdown of TAB1 show unambiguously that the BIR1/TAB1 interaction is crucial for
XIAP induced TAK1 and
NF-kappaB activation ... Disruption of BIR1 dimerization abolishes
XIAP mediated
NF-kappaB activation, implicating a proximity induced mechanism for TAK1 activation
